THIRD WORLD EYE-CARE SOCIETY PROGRAM IN OLONGAPO!

Eye care professionals from the Third World Eye Care Society Canada (TWECS) group have arrived in Olongapo City on November 10, 2008. The group immediately visited the Iram Resettlement Area where residents were given free eye consultations and check-ups.

TWECS visits developing countries to help people in their areas with eye problems. The team comprising TWECS includes world class eye care professionals like eye surgeons, optometrists, and other volunteers from different parts of the world.

TWECS plans to serve 400-500people each day during their 11-day stay in Olongapo. Local eye doctors are also helping TWECS in this undertaking.

TWECS will be giving free eye consultations, check-ups and glasses until November 21, 2008 in various parts of Olongapo City.

TWECS have already visited countries like India, Peru, Cambodia, Mexico and Kenya. The group will also be visiting Brazil and St. Vincent in the West Indies in the coming years.

The group was founded by Dr. Marina Roma-March in 1995. Her grandmother is an immigrant from the Philippines.

Mayor James ‘Bong’ Gordon Jr. with the eye care professionals from the Third World Eye Care Society- Canada (TWECS). The group held a free eye consultation and examination at the Iram Resettlement Area on November 10, 2008.
